the science station with text that reads 6 reasons to use stations in middle school science

Classroom stations aren't just for elementary school! They can revolutionize your middle school science class, maximizing learning time, promoting active learning and making real-world connections. It's the classroom strategy you never knew you needed. Sometimes, direct instruction in science is exactly what you need to do in order to get students to understand certain concepts. In Earth Space, Life science and physical science classes, middle school students need to learn difficult science standards that can be taught explicitly. You can transform your direct teaching style to get students more engaged in the learning process. Learn about how you can direct instruction in science to boost engagement.
